A new hub at Ayrshire College’s Kilwinning campus has been given an amazing cash boost.Magnox has just announced a £499,999 contribution to the college’s Future Skills Hub, due to open in late 2021.The cash has come from Nuclear Decommissioning Authority (NDA) funding – allocated through the Magnox socio-economic scheme.The aim of the scheme is to mitigate the impact of decommissioning and support sustainable communities in which Magnox operates.David Wallace, NDA stakeholder relations and socio economics manager, said: “Support for this project has leveraged much-needed match-funding, which will help build a sustainable future long after the Hunterston A site has closed.“These new training facilities will prepare current and future.
